It’s the new Saab 9-4X! The fact that Fourex is an American brand of condoms and an Australian lager shouldn’t get [both remaining] fans of the brand up in arms (or wherever). Thanks to a “premature leak” on Saab’s Chilean website (David Hasselhoff is big down there too), The Motor Authority reveals an SUV-lite that looks reasonably appealing. And we’re willing to bet the key willl be between the seats. That said, the ostensibly Swedish model (built in Ramos, Mexico) could well suffer the same fate as the abortive 9-2X (Saabaru) and 9-7X (Saablazer), based as it is on Caddy’s new SRX platform. In fact, this time ’round, the Saabillac will be competing with a nearly identical iteration in the same GM “sales channel” (i.e. HUMMER, Cadillac and Saab). It could even appear in the same showroom. How great is that?
